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Thorne South to Reedham (Norfolk) start from as little as £13.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Thorne South to Reedham (Norfolk) start from £50.00 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Thorne South to Reedham (Norfolk) are available for £70.10 one way

Facilities and Services at Thorne South

Thorne South station doesn't have a ticket office, but it does provide ticket machines where you can collect tickets, especially if you've purchased them online. This convenience ensures that you're not left without tickets when you're ready to travel. It's worth noting, however, that the station lacks accessible ticket machines, which may be a consideration for some travelers.

In terms of accessibility, the station offers step-free access, making it appealing for those who require ease of movement. There are ramps for accessing trains, but no accessible toilets or seating areas, which are factors to keep in mind when visiting.

Customer service at Thorne South primarily relies on information screens and announcements, with no staff help available on-site, though help points are available. CCTV is in place for security, contributing to the safety of passengers. Although there are no refreshment facilities, ATMs, or shops, there is the assurance of a safe journey with a CCTV-monitored environment and accessible transport links, such as local taxis, which you can arrange through platforms like Cab4You.

Onward Travel and Transport Links

Thorne South station facilitates easy onward travel connections, offering several transport options beyond train services. Rail replacement services are stationed at a nearby pick-up/drop-off point, about 600 yards from the station. Notably, for diverse travel needs, there are local bus services available, with a bus line reachable at 0871 200 2233. However, those looking for bicycle hire options would need to explore services outside the station, as they are not provided on-site. Facilities and Amenities at Reedham Station

At Reedham (Norfolk) station, travelers enjoy essential amenities designed for comfort and convenience. Although the station lacks a traditional ticket office, it features efficient ticket machines ensuring quick access to your travel documents. Collecting tickets purchased online is seamless, and the station enhances accessibility with induction loops and step-free access to Platform 1 from the car park. For those requiring aid, support is available through customer help points, with assistance bookings available via the Passenger Assist service.

While basic amenities like toilets and refreshment facilities are absent, Reedham captures visitors' needs with covered seating areas and ample bicycle storage. The station is equipped with CCTV for added security, while the adjacent parking facilities offer affordable rates with spaces for daily and annual use.

Onward Travel Options

Traveling from Reedham station offers various links to other transport modes. In cases of rail disruptions, a thoughtful rail replacement service operates directly from the station entrance, although due to space constraints, it is limited to mini-buses. This ensures continuity in your journey, connecting you seamlessly to other lines or local destinations.
